Job Title Asset Co-ordinatorJob Description Summary As a key member of the new Waikeria PPP, your role will be to manage the asset register both before and after the go-live date. This will involve overseeing approximately 200,000 assets.Job DescriptionHe aha te mea nui o te ao. He tāngata, he tāngata, he tāngataWhat is the most important thing in the world? It is people, it is people, it is people.With a reputation for excellence in providing service and support to our customers, Cushman & Wakefield is a market leader in Facility Management and Facilities Service delivery. We have a genuine commitment to continually strengthen client relationships and raise the bar in terms of customer service and delivery outcomes.We have an exclusive opening for an Asset Coordinator based onsite at Waikeria Prison. Join our team as a vital member of the new Waikeria PPP, responsible for managing the asset register before and after the go-live date. With approximately 200,000 assets, this role is critical in ensuring all assets are loaded before the go-live date of 29 November 2024. This position will also continue as a full-time role after Service Commencement, overseeing all PPMs and life cycle management of assets.If you thrive on unique challenges and excel in multitasking, this role will be the perfect one for you.KEY RESPONSIBILITIES INCLUDE:You will be the mastermind behind managing, tracking, and optimising crucial assets within the facility.Oversee the lifecycle of assets, from acquisition to disposal, maintaining meticulous records and ensuring adherence to confidentiality guidelines.Implement asset tracking systems, enabling real-time monitoring and safeguarding against loss or misuse.Conduct regular audits to assess asset condition, performance, and compliance with established standards.Collaborate closely with facility management and maintenance teams to support asset needs and plan for future requirements.Liaise with the Internal/External Asset Management team to update and maintain the Asset Management Plans as well as processing life-cycle claims.Coordinate and secure BWOF compliance.BACKGROUND AND EXPERIENCEA minimum of 3 years of administration and coordination experience, ideally in an FM/AM environment.The ability to plan and prioritise workload.The ability to work autonomously with minimal direction.Proactive in identifying issues and recommending solutions.Working knowledge of Asset Management software packages, such as JDE or SAP is highly desirable.Cushman & Wakefield's remuneration package includes:Free Life Insurance.Free Income replacement insurance.Discounted Medical cover with Southern Cross.Access to Marram Trust holiday / medical program.Candidates must be eligible to work in New Zealand to apply.Only shortlisted candidates will be contacted.We're committed to providing work-life balance for our people in an inclusive, rewarding environment.
